Handover — Quillbase admin table

Bulk edits in the admin table now go through the new batch endpoint. Support can select up to 200 rows; larger selections get rejected with a clear error, not a timeout. Undo window is 15 minutes. If a batch stalls, check the job queue before retrying. The relevant settings are listed below for reference.

config for fahap-badup:
[ralath]
port = 3000
region = lower-2
host = ralath.tolvaqsys.corp
timeout_ms = 3000
retries = 4

The Cascade Reseller Programme added 14 partners this quarter. Margin contribution sits at 9.2%, below the 12% target. Two partners in the Norwold region account for most of the shortfall; both are under review. Onboarding costs were 18% over plan, driven by extended certification cycles. Finance should note that tier discounts will be recalibrated before Q3 invoicing. Partner rebates are frozen pending that recalibration. The following note outlines the strategic direction ahead of the decision.

board note of bawep-tajef: Queniusek Systems plans to raise the Quenvan list price by 53.1 percent in March. The pricing group signed off on a budget of $176.4 million for Project Drueth. The renewal with Casionix Partners closes at $142.5 million a year, 8.3 percent below the last contract. Project Fraax slips by six weeks because of the tooling delay.

The RoomMatch parity engine queries the internal QuoteBridge service for canonical rates before flagging channel discrepancies. All calls require bearer authentication; unauthenticated requests return a 401 with no body. Reviewers should confirm the client reads the credential from config rather than hardcoding it. For reference during review, the current QuoteBridge key follows.

service key, fawip-bajef: kto11_Qt5wZK9vdNC

**Mgmt Meeting Minutes — Retiring the Brightline Range**

Quick recap for sales leads at Fenholt Supplies: we agreed to retire the Brightline fixture range by year-end. Remaining stock moves to clearance pricing next month, and accounts on standing orders get migrated to the Lumetta range. Trade-in incentives were approved in principle. The confidential note on next steps sits just below.

board note of bajof-bajeg: The pricing group signed off on a budget of $13.4 million for Project Sildor. The renewal with Lamixek Holdings closes at $48.9 million a year, 49 percent above the last contract.